While this restaurant is never terrible it always leaves me a little disappointed. Tonight my wife and I went to dinner. First lets talk about the entryway. After entering you wait in an area that is only partially visible from the dinning area and you often have to wait quit a while for someone to recognize your there and take you to a table. When we were finally seated the hostess immediately asked if we wanted cocktails. We requested water while we decided on what cocktails we wanted. The water came immediately and shortly there after the waitress brought the traditional bread and dipping sauce, returning later to ask about cocktails. After we ordered drinks she asked if we were ready to order our food. We were ready so we ordered. My wife ordered a steak, well done, and I had the Ahi Tuna. Our salads came immediately. They were cold and crisp and beautifully presented. Unfortunately our cocktails were still being prepared in the bar. When our drinks were delivered, my wife’s drink was fine but the Manhattan I ordered contained bitters and I’m pretty sure a splash of soda. A Manhattan, like a martini is only two ingredients, bourbon & sweet vermouth. The taste of the bitters were overwhelming and I sent the drink back, something I almost never do. The waitress was very nice about it and returned the drink to the bar. Shortly after we finished our salads the entrées arrived followed by the reordered Manhattan. My wife’s steak was cooked perfectly and my Ahi, while slightly over cooked was really delicious. We very much enjoyed both of our entrées. I would have preferred to have had time to enjoy our cocktails followed by the salad and then the entrées. All in all the service felt like a coffee shop rather than a place for a leisurely dinner. Finally no one returned to our table to see if we liked our food or see if we wanted dessert or coffee. As we were finishing our entrées the waitress whizzed by our table, dropped the bill and said, «Whenever you’re ready.» All in all, while the food here is pretty reliable the service is iffy at best and certainly not in line with the price tag. Frankly I think we would have had better service at any of the local coffee shops. I wish they would get it together. I really want to like this place.

I would say my rating is an average of what I have experienced every time I have had this restaurant. The Service: Super nice waitresses(for the most part). All of the women I have had as a waitress have been super friendly and welcoming. I have had one waiter who was a less desirable in a waiter(he didn’t really check up on our table, and kind of made our party feel like we were burdening him). The Atmosphere: Lounge style, dark and somewhat secluded from other parties. Overall pretty nice place. The Food: Okay, where do I begin. I ordered pasta here once, it was the most bland pasta I have ever had as an adult. Really. No salt, pepper or anything else. Kraft mac and cheese was more flavorful than this pasta. Someone Else who was dining with me however ordered the steak bistro salad– which was amazing– at the time. The veggies were sautéed in balsamic, the steak was tender and juicy and the whole salad was topped with a crunchy jalapeño(might be another chili) popper. Delicious. Heres the catch– I have returned many times for this salad, receiving completely different quality and flavored version of the same exact order. The last time I ordered it, the steak was dry and thin beef jerky-esque. The veggies have been raw. It has been delicious again, it might be the chef. Overall: Too inconsistent for my tastes.
